At a glance
Rosie Duffield is currently a Independent MP for Canterbury, and has represented the constituency for 9 years, 0 months. The latest election majority is 8,653. They are most active voting on Crime / Justice. They have voted in 57.5 % of eligible Commons divisions, compared with a Commons average of 72.7 %. For financial year 2024-25, Rosie Duffield submitted £253,889 of expenses, which is 12 % higher than the average MP. Asked 54 parliamentary questions in the last 12 months.
